Gabby Agbonlahorclaims 47m Man Utd star is wasted at Old Trafford

Metro by Metro
1 minute ago
0 0

Former Premier League striker Gabby Agbonlahor (Picture: talkSPORT)

Former Premier League striker Gabby Agbonlahor believes Bruno Fernandes may come to feel like he ‘wasted’ the best years of his career by playing at Manchester United.

Fernandes has been, without doubt, United’s most consistent performer since joining the club from Sporting for an initial fee of around £47million back in 2020.

The 31-year-old has racked up 105 goals and 103 appearances in 319 appearances for the club, while also winning the Sir Matt Busby Player of the Year award on four occasions.

And despite playing the first of the season in a deeper role under Ruben Amorim, his two assists at the weekend in a 3-1 win over Aston Villa means only Erling Haaland (29) has bettered his goal contribution tally (23) in the league this campaign.

Discussing Fernandes’ current form, former Villa striker Agbonlahor insisted United would be in a vastly different position without their talismanic captain.

‘I am scared to think where Manchester United would have been in the last five years, especially this season, without Bruno Fernandes,’ he told talkSPORT.

’27 Premier League appearances, seven goals, 16 assists. No matter how bad they have been, he has turned up.’

While Fernandes has broken several records during his time at Old Trafford, the Portuguese midfielder has only won two trophies with the Red Devils: The FA Cup in 2024 and Carabao Cup in 2023.

And Agbonlahor wonders whether not having a league or Champions League trophy on his resume may have Fernandes regretting his decision to stay at United for so long.

He added: ‘But I said this in a previous show a few months ago. He is 32 in September, he has won one FA Cup, one League Cup for Manchester United.

‘Could he leave Manchester United one day and look back and say, ‘Did I waste my best years at Manchester United?’

‘Because you look at someone like De Bruyne – won it all at Manchester City.

‘But Bruno Fernandes, he is that good, he deserves to leave the Premier League winning the Premier League and also Champions League for me – that good.’

Fernandes is under contract at United until 2027, with the option of a further year, but reports suggest he has a £56.6 million (€65m) release clause in his current deal, which can be triggered by overseas clubs.

But interim head coach Michael Carrick insisted at the weekend that the club have no desire to let their skipper leave in the summer.

‘In terms of the club and moving forward, it’s difficult for me to get involved in too much of that,’ the United interim manager told reporters.

‘Bruno is definitely not someone we’d want to lose, I can say that.

‘This summer and beyond that, it’s difficult for me to kind of go too far with that.

‘But certainly, he’s important for us and he’s definitely not one we would want to lose.’
